But Pattaya is not only a male only playground as women also enjoy it. Living and shopping is cheap by most standards. You can live comfortably on 25% of what you would spend in the west. Good food, warm tropical weather, and the only annoyance is the occasional drunk obnoxious tourist. So once a person gets use to the laid back low stress lifestyle Pattaya offers it is hard to go back to anyplace else. Compared to Bangkok’s noise, pollution and traffic, Pattaya is most certainly an upgrade with a view.
